Carlo and sporting director Simon Rolfs were asked about the status of Tach’s future at a meeting between Bayer officials and Bayer Leverkusen supporters’ club representatives at the Bayer Arena on Tuesday.

Rolfes responded diplomatically, but Carlo didn’t hesitate: “Well, I have nothing against Max Eberl, absolutely not!” The 60-year-old muttered, adding: ” And I won’t negotiate with him.

The unusually ferocious attack on Eberl led to a clear conclusion: negotiations on Tah’s transfer are currently on hold. Carlo’s anger likely stems from Bayern’s apparent failure to abide by the agreement between the two clubs.
